Valerie Roy - Modèle shares your facial care secrets

Valerie Roy, who began her modelling career at Elite Model Management in New York City, successfully became the "face of the brand" for numerous products, securing product endorsements and working with prominent brands such as the following:

Gordon's Gin, Ford Motor Company, Savana Drinks, L'Oreal, Coca-Cola, Stern's, Nestle, Tag Heuer, Rolex, Bentley, Jafra Cosmetics, Dunhill, Estée Lauder, Stella, Donna Karan, Martell, Woolworth's Beauty, Philip Morris, and Almay.

Throughout her modelling career, she has been featured in several magazines including Cosmopolitan, Marie Claire, Elle, WWD, Shape, Oprah Magazine, Femina, Stitch Fashion Magazine, Kai Zen Magazine and Runner's World.

She served as one of the top models on "Project Runway" and its companion show "Models of the Runway" and earned a positive reputation under the constant scrutiny of reality television. She has also appeared in television programmes such as Black Box, Power, as well as numerous television commercials.

She gained her worldly expertise by interacting with culturally diverse people in more than 22 countries, including the United States, the United Arab Emirates, France, Germany, the United Kingdom, South Africa, Switzerland and Italy, while maintaining continuous professional contacts.
